9

Mon Android Studio fonctionnait bien jusqu'au matin, mais depuis ce soir j'ai une erreur disant "Echec de la synchronisation de la connexion: Connexion expirée: connectez-vous Si vous êtes derrière un proxy HTTP, veuillez configurer les paramètres de proxy dans IDE ou Gradle. ". Je n'utilise aucun serveur proxy. Même l'option pour le proxy HTTP est définie sur "aucun proxy". Je ne sais pas comment faire fonctionner ça. J'ai essayé de donner l'accès public à Android Studio dans le pare-feu, mais cela n'a pas fonctionné.Android Studio: Échec de la synchronisation Gradle: La connexion a expiré: connectez

Toute aide ou solution est la bienvenue.

P.S. Ma version Android Studio est 2.2.3

Merci!

+0

J'ai la même question, très étrange –

+0

moi aussi face même problème – Naruto

+0

avant d'essayer une solution, utilisez un proxy ou vpn. – kokabi

Répondre

6

Je pense que c'est un problème de réseau. Mon projet ne parvient actuellement pas à construire à moins que je passe l'argument --offline à gradle. Je pense que l'interruption de S3 affecte les dépendances d'hébergement de repos.

Essayez ./gradlew tasks --offline

Ou, pour faire courir studio android en mode hors-ligne, suivez les instructions: https://stackoverflow.com/a/32173577/1043518

+1

Je suppose que vous avez raison, déconnecté l'a corrigé. Je suppose que certaines de mes dépendances sont affectées par la panne dont vous parlez. – ark

4

Pour moi, ce fut le pare-feu. Certainement, seulement cela. Après avoir ajouté Android Studio à sa liste blanche, tout fonctionne comme un charme.

5

J'ai copié un projet qui a été créé ailleurs. Après avoir retiré ces informations d'identification proxy:

systemProp.http.proxyPassword=your_password 

systemProp.http.proxyHost=host_Ip_address 

systemProp.http.proxyUser=your_username 

systemProp.http.proxyPort=port_number 

dans les gradle.properties, il a travaillé comme un charme.

1

Ne pas oublier proxy https dans gradle.properties

systemProp.http.proxyHost=your.proxy.host 
systemProp.http.proxyPort=8080 
systemProp.http.proxyUser=username 
systemProp.http.proxyPassword=password 
# 
# DO NOT forget https proxy, too! 
# 
systemProp.https.proxyHost=your.proxy.host 
systemProp.https.proxyPort=8080 
systemProp.https.proxyUser=username 
systemProp.https.proxyPassword=password 
+1

Il n'utilise aucun proxy. –

+0

@AntonMalmygin mon erreur, désolé. – diewland